This was the second time that the Blood Riders has held this event at this venue and the Branch supported them with a good mix of bikes, those attending were Ian & Rose 1930 16H, Roger’s Featherbed Commando Yellow Special, Colin’s DOHC Manx, Dave’s Fastback Commando and Ian’s Dominator Deluxe.  Due to barely making a profit at this event the Blood Riders will not be returning to this venue

Following the cancellation of this show last year due to atrocious weather 2016’s Festival was blessed with excellent weather and as a result the Branch was able to attend for the first time and put on a display of members bikes, those attending and their bikes were as follows;   Colin’s Manx & Yellow Peril, Roger’s Yellow Special, Dave’s fastback Commando, Ian’s Blackburn engined Hemming, Chris & Jill’s B3T Trials Outfit and Mikes Model 19.  Mike unfortunately had a puncture on the way home and had to call out the RAC

It was also nice to be able to meet up with our old Chairman Jim Rendell (who is on the mend following his recent illness) and Ray who only brought his A35 Van along as his 99ss had had an engine seizure whilst on the NOC National Rally
